CdCu2GeTe4 is a quaternary chalcogenide compound combining cadmium, copper, germanium, and tellurium elements. This is a research-phase material studied primarily for its semiconductor and thermoelectric properties rather than a mature commercial alloy, belonging to the family of complex chalcogenides that show promise for energy conversion applications.
